10 Essential Political Science Datasets for Research and Analysis
Political science datasets are collections of structured information and data related to various aspects of politics and government. These datasets can include information on elections, political parties, public opinion, policy decisions, international relations, and other political phenomena. They are used by political scientists and researchers to analyze and understand political processes, behavior, and outcomes.

1. What are political science datasets?
Political science datasets are collections of structured and organized data that contain information relevant to the field of political science. These datasets often include data on elections, political parties, public opinion, government policies, international relations, and other aspects of political systems.
2. Why are political science datasets important for research and analysis?
Political science datasets provide researchers and analysts with valuable information and insights into various political phenomena. By analyzing these datasets, researchers can study patterns, trends, and relationships within political systems, make informed predictions, test hypotheses, and contribute to the understanding of political processes and behavior.
3. How can I access political science datasets for research?
Political science datasets can be accessed through various sources. Many universities and research institutions provide access to their own datasets through their websites or data repositories. Additionally, there are several online platforms and databases that offer a wide range of political science datasets, some of which are freely available, while others may require a subscription or purchase.
4. What criteria should I consider when selecting political science datasets for my research?
When selecting political science datasets for research and analysis, it is important to consider several criteria. These include the relevance of the dataset to your research question, the quality and reliability of the data, the scope and coverage of the dataset, the level of detail provided, the availability of documentation and metadata, and any legal or ethical considerations associated with the use of the dataset.
5. Can I combine multiple political science datasets for my research?
Yes, it is often beneficial to combine multiple political science datasets to enhance the depth and breadth of your research. By integrating different datasets, you can explore relationships and correlations across various dimensions of political science, validate findings, and gain a more comprehensive understanding of the topic under investigation. However, it is important to ensure compatibility and consistency between the datasets and consider any potential limitations or biases that may arise from combining them.
6. Are there any limitations or challenges associated with using political science datasets?
While political science datasets offer valuable opportunities for research and analysis, there are some limitations and challenges to be aware of. These may include data quality issues, missing or incomplete data, potential biases in data collection methods, limitations in the scope or coverage of the dataset, and the need for careful interpretation of the results. Additionally, some datasets may have restrictions on their use due to privacy concerns or copyright regulations.
